1. The Unique Biodiversity of Sundarban:
Sundarban is the world’s largest tidal halophytic mangrove forest, covering over 10,000 square kilometers. This ecosystem is home to an extraordinary variety of plant and animal life, some of which are endemic to the region. The Sundarban forest is renowned for the Royal Bengal Tiger, one of the most majestic and endangered species, as well as numerous other wildlife species.
- Flora: Sundarban’s mangrove forests feature a variety of tree species adapted to the saline, marshy environment. Species like Sundari, Goran, and Gewa trees dominate the landscape, giving the area its name.
- Fauna: In addition to the iconic Royal Bengal Tiger, the Sundarban forest is home to spotted deer, saltwater crocodiles, otters, Gangetic dolphins, and an impressive array of bird species. Birdwatchers can witness kingfishers, herons, and Brahminy kites, while marine life enthusiasts might catch a glimpse of the rare Irrawaddy dolphin.

3. Highlights of a 2-Night, 3-Day Sundarban Tour:
A typical 2-night, 3-day Sundarban tour itinerary is packed with a variety of activities and sites that showcase the unique beauty of the region.
Day 1: Arrival and Mangrove Exploration
- Journey from Kolkata to Sundarban: Begin the tour with a scenic journey to Godkhali, followed by a boat ride to the resort or eco-lodge.
- Evening Cruise: Many tours offer an introductory evening cruise along the river channels, providing the first glimpse of the mangrove forest. This time allows visitors to soak in the peaceful surroundings and spot early signs of wildlife.
Day 2: Boat Safari and Wildlife Sightings
- Boat Safari: The day typically begins with an early morning boat safari through narrow creeks and dense mangroves. The boat ride offers an opportunity to see the wildlife of Sundarban up close, including crocodiles sunning on the riverbanks and exotic bird species flying overhead.
- Visit to Watchtowers: Many tours include stops at popular watchtowers like Sajnekhali, Dobanki, and Sudhanyakhali. These watchtowers are strategically placed near freshwater ponds, which attract animals, giving visitors a better chance to spot the elusive Bengal tiger.
- Interaction with Local Culture: Sundarban tours often include visits to local villages, where travelers can learn about the unique lifestyle of the local communities who depend on the forest for their livelihood. Folk performances and traditional meals enhance the cultural experience.
Day 3: Sunrise View and Departure
- Sunrise Over the Mangroves: Early morning is one of the best times to appreciate the serene beauty of Sundarban. Watching the sun rise over the mist-covered mangrove forest is a sight to behold.
- Return to Kolkata: After breakfast, visitors are transported back to Godkhali, and the journey back to Kolkata concludes the trip.
4. Cultural Richness and Local Heritage:
Sundarban’s allure isn’t limited to its wildlife and natural landscapes. The region also has a rich cultural heritage, steeped in folk traditions and spiritual beliefs. Many Sundarban tours offer a glimpse into local customs and traditions, including folk dances, songs, and storytelling that revolve around the forest.
- Local Festivals: The Bonbibi festival, dedicated to the forest goddess Bonbibi, showcases the locals’ deep connection to the forest and their reverence for its natural wonders. This festival offers visitors a chance to witness traditional dances and songs that are unique to the Sundarban area.
- Artisanal Crafts: The communities in Sundarban create beautiful handicrafts using natural resources from the forest, including handcrafted baskets and mats. Many tours give visitors an opportunity to shop for authentic, locally-made souvenirs.
5. Birdwatching and Photography Opportunities:
Sundarban is a paradise for birdwatchers and photographers alike. From the majestic Brahminy kite to colorful kingfishers and rare migratory birds, Sundarban’s bird population is both diverse and abundant. The waterways, mangroves, and creeks provide unique backdrops for photography, capturing the essence of this untouched wilderness.
- Ideal for Wildlife Photography: The mangrove forests, riverine landscapes, and unique wildlife provide photographers with ample opportunities to capture stunning images. Early morning and late afternoon lighting make for excellent photography conditions.
- Birdwatching: The rich variety of bird species makes Sundarban a popular destination for birdwatchers. Sajnekhali Bird Sanctuary is a designated area where one can spot numerous local and migratory bird species, perfect for avid birdwatchers.
6. Importance of Eco-Tourism in Sundarban:
Sundarban’s delicate ecosystem is vulnerable to environmental changes, and tourism here has gradually shifted toward eco-friendly practices. Responsible tourism in Sundarban emphasizes respect for the natural environment and local culture, supporting conservation efforts and sustainable livelihoods for local communities.
- Eco-Friendly Lodges and Tours: Many tour operators and resorts in Sundarban have adopted eco-friendly practices, including waste reduction, renewable energy, and sustainable food sourcing.
- Contribution to Local Economy: Eco-tourism helps generate income for the local communities, reducing their dependence on forest resources and promoting sustainable practices.
